Is Frank Sinatra: One More for the Road Worth Watching? Honest Movie Review & Audience Verdict (2019)

Explore the extraordinary story of the man who possessed one of the greatest voices of the century. Known as The Voice, The Leader, and Ol’ Blue Eyes, Frank Sinatra conquered all aspects of entertainment, singing and acting. Through archival performances and interviews, journey through Frank’s remarkable life, from his troubled birth in 1915 to the day The Voice was sadly silenced.
